Species details

Kingdom
Animalia (animals)
Class
Reptilia (reptiles)
Family
Scincidae (skinks)
Scientific name
Tiliqua scincoides (White, 1790)
Common name
eastern blue-tongued lizard
Type reference
White, J. (1790). Journal of a Voyage to New South Wales, with sixty five plates of non-descript animals, birds, lizards, serpents, curious cones of trees and other natural productions. Appendix. London : Debrett 299 pp.
WildNet taxon ID
104
Alternate name(s)
eastern blue-tongue
common blue-tongue
common bluetongue
Nature Conservation Act 1992 (NCA) status
Least concern
Conservation significant
No
Endemicity
Native
Pest status
Nil
Species environment
Terrestrial
